I saw them in my 6" Maksutov at 60x but was informed
by another observer that it is not a split but:

"There are 2 stars near the nucleus. According to ECU, they are
GSC0333400738, mag 10.9, and GSC0333400788, mag 8.7."

Mike - Halifax, Nova Scotia, Canada

A friend just reported seeing the "split nucleus" in an 8-inch Dob, so I
checked TheSky. As of 2:00 UT on Oct 29, 2007 (22:00 EDT Oct 28) that 8th
mag star is only one arc minute from the calculated position of Holmes.
Another friend shows the second "object" in his recent CCD image and says
that it is not "keeping up" with the comet. I doubt that the comet is
breaking up and people are just seeing a bright background star.
